The Monarch San Antonio - A Legacy of Service and Sophistication
The Monarch San Antonio, part of the Curio Collection by Hilton, is a 200-room, 17-story boutique hotel located in the Hemisfair District of downtown San Antonio. It is set to open in early 2026 and is inspired by the Monarch butterfly that migrates through the region each winter. The hotel will feature a full-service spa, a terrace pool, and five food and beverage concepts, including a rooftop restaurant and bar.
Just steps from the iconic River Walk and The Alamo, The Monarch will offer more than a place to stay. It will be a place to belong, to connect, and to be inspired.

Position Overview
The Server Assistant at Aleteo Rooftop Restaurant supports the service team by maintaining table readiness, assisting with food and beverage delivery, and ensuring smooth service flow in a high energy rooftop environment. This role is essential to pacing, cleanliness, and guest satisfaction while upholding the elevated standards of the Aleteo dining experience.
Essential Functions
Service Support and Execution
- Assist servers with table maintenance, clearing, and resetting throughout service.
- Deliver food and beverages to tables as directed by service staff.
- Support course pacing and dining room flow.
- Maintain awareness of guest needs and service timing.
Guest Experience
- Provide courteous, attentive support to guests when interacting tableside.
- Respond promptly to guest requests and communicate needs to servers.
- Support a lively, welcoming rooftop atmosphere.
- Maintain professionalism during peak service periods.
Operational Responsibilities
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of service stations and dining areas.
- Assist with polishing glassware, silverware, and tableware.
- Support opening and closing side work duties.
- Communicate effectively with servers, bartenders, and runners.
Teamwork and Professionalism
- Work collaboratively with servers, bartenders, runners, and leadership.
- Maintain a professional appearance and positive attitude.
- Demonstrate reliability, urgency, and attention to detail.
- Accept coaching and feedback to support development.
Compliance and Safety
- Follow all health, safety, sanitation, and food handling standards.
- Adhere to company policies and brand standards.
- Maintain a safe and clean work environment.
Other Duties
- Perform additional responsibilities as assigned by restaurant leadership.
Physical & Working Conditions
- Must be able to stand for extended periods and work in a fast-paced kitchen environment.
- Flexible schedule including weekends, holidays, and special events.
Qualifications
- Previous restaurant experience preferred but not required.
- Strong work ethic and attention to detail.
- Ability to work efficiently in a fast paced, energetic environment.
- Positive attitude and willingness to learn.
- Food and Alcohol Service Certifications required or ability to obtain.
